The Top 13 Reasons Your Air Conditioner Is Not Turning On and How to Solve Them

Why Your Air Conditioner Won’t Turn On: Troubleshooting Guide

1. Power Problems

A frequent cause for an air conditioner’s failure to start is related to its power supply. Initially, ensure that the AC unit is securely connected to an outlet and confirm the power source’s functionality. Moreover, the thermostat’s batteries play a crucial role; low or depleted batteries might inhibit the start-up of your AC system. Addressing these fundamental power-related aspects can often quickly resolve the issue, restoring your air conditioner’s functionality and ensuring your environment returns to a comfortable temperature without significant delay.

2. Tripped Circuit Breaker

When an air conditioner ceases to function, a tripped circuit breaker is a common culprit, effectively cutting off power to the unit. To address this, locate your home’s circuit breaker panel and identify the specific breaker dedicated to your HVAC system. If you find it has tripped, resetting it is crucial. Additionally, it’s important to verify that the breaker is adequately rated to manage the electrical load demanded by your AC unit. Ensuring compatibility between the breaker’s capacity and the AC’s requirements is essential for preventing future power interruptions and maintaining consistent, efficient cooling performance.

3. Faulty Thermostat

A dysfunctional thermostat often lies at the heart of an air conditioner’s failure to activate. It’s vital to ensure that your thermostat is not only set to a temperature below the ambient room temperature but also switched to cooling mode. An outdated or malfunctioning thermostat can impede your AC’s operation. In such cases, replacing the thermostat with a more modern or functional model can swiftly resolve the issue, reinstating your air conditioner’s ability to cool your space effectively. This simple check and potential upgrade can significantly enhance your home’s comfort and your system’s efficiency.

4. Common Cooling Issues

Common impediments to an air conditioner’s functionality, such as clogged air filters, obstructed vents, or ice-encased coils, can hinder its operation. To circumvent these issues, it’s imperative to engage in routine maintenance, which includes cleaning or replacing air filters to promote unimpeded airflow. Additionally, a thorough examination of the vents and condenser coils is crucial to detect and mitigate any blockages or ice accumulation. Taking these proactive steps not only ensures your AC unit’s optimal performance but also extends its lifespan, keeping your environment comfortably cool.

6. Refrigerant Leaks

A deficiency in refrigerant, often due to leaks, can severely impair your air conditioner’s ability to cool or even power on. Such leaks compromise the system’s functionality and efficiency, necessitating professional intervention. Certified technicians are equipped to meticulously locate and repair these leaks, followed by accurately recharging the system with the correct amount of refrigerant. This crucial repair and maintenance step not only restores your AC unit’s cooling capacity but also ensures it operates as intended, maintaining optimal performance and preventing future issues related to refrigerant levels.

7. Compressor Troubles

The compressor acts as the pivotal component of your air conditioning system, driving its functionality. When it encounters issues, whether from electrical malfunctions or motor failure, the entire system’s operation can be halted, preventing your AC from initiating. Addressing these compressor-related challenges requires the expertise of a skilled technician, who can accurately diagnose and rectify the problem. Their specialized knowledge and tools enable them to identify the root cause and implement effective repairs, ensuring that your AC system resumes its critical role in maintaining a cool and comfortable indoor environment.

8. Faulty Capacitor

Capacitors play a crucial role in jumpstarting the motors of your air conditioning unit. A malfunctioning capacitor is a common reason why an AC may fail to activate. Expert technicians possess the necessary tools to conduct tests on these capacitors, determining their condition with precision. Should they find a capacitor to be defective, they have the capability to replace it efficiently. This repair is often a key to reviving your air conditioner’s functionality, ensuring it can once again provide the essential cooling needed to maintain a comfortable indoor climate.

9. Blown Fuses

A blown fuse within your air conditioning unit acts as a significant barrier, interrupting the flow of power and rendering the system inoperative. It is imperative to examine the fuses located in the AC’s disconnect box for signs of failure. Replacing a blown fuse is a critical step towards restoration. However, it’s equally important to delve deeper and address the root cause behind the fuse’s malfunction. Identifying and rectifying this underlying issue is key to preventing future disruptions in power flow, ensuring your air conditioner remains reliable and ready to deliver cooling comfort when you need it most.

10. Wiring Problems

Faulty or loose wiring within your air conditioning system poses a significant risk, potentially leading to electrical malfunctions that inhibit the unit’s ability to start. Before attempting any inspection or repair, it’s crucial to ensure safety by disconnecting power to the AC unit. Enlisting a qualified professional to conduct a thorough examination and repair any wiring issues is essential. Their expertise allows them to safely identify and rectify any electrical problems, restoring your AC unit’s functionality and ensuring it operates smoothly without posing any safety hazards. This proactive measure can prevent further damage and ensure your air conditioner is ready to provide reliable cooling when temperatures rise.

11. Sensor Malfunctions

Modern air conditioning units are equipped with sensors designed to monitor conditions crucial for optimal performance. When these sensors malfunction, they can significantly impair your AC’s functionality, leading to inefficiencies or a complete inability to start. To address this issue, consulting the user manual can provide initial guidance. However, for a comprehensive diagnosis and effective resolution, seeking the expertise of an HVAC technician is advisable. They possess the specialized knowledge and tools required to accurately identify faulty sensors and replace them, ensuring your air conditioning unit regains its efficiency and reliability, thereby maintaining a comfortable indoor environment.

12. External Factors

External elements such as debris accumulation, overgrown vegetation, or an obstructed condenser unit play a significant role in impacting the efficiency of your air conditioning system. It’s imperative to maintain a routine of clearing and cleaning the vicinity of your outdoor unit. Ensuring this area remains free from obstruction is crucial for facilitating proper airflow. Regular maintenance in this regard not only enhances the operational efficiency of your AC but also extends its lifespan, preventing potential malfunctions that can arise from these external hindrances. This proactive step is essential for sustaining optimal cooling performance, especially during peak usage periods.

13. Broken Fan Motor

A non-functional fan motor in your air conditioning system halts the circulation of air, rendering the unit ineffective in cooling your space. This issue requires the attention of a skilled technician who can conduct a thorough inspection of the motor. Upon diagnosis, if the motor is found to be beyond repair, the technician has the capability to replace it with a new one. This crucial intervention restores the unit’s ability to circulate air efficiently, ensuring your living or working environment returns to a comfortable temperature. Engaging a professional for this task ensures that the replacement is performed accurately and safely, reinstating your AC’s functionality and reliability.

Frequently Asked Questions

 

Q1: My AC unit is not turning on at all. What should I do?

A1: When troubleshooting an unresponsive air conditioner, begin with the basics: ensure the power supply is active, verify the thermostat is correctly set, and check if the air filters are clean. Should these steps not resolve the issue, it’s advisable to seek the expertise of a professional HVAC technician for a comprehensive diagnosis and repair, ensuring your system returns to optimal performance efficiently and safely.

Q2: Can I fix a refrigerant leak myself?

A2: Dealing with refrigerant in air conditioning systems necessitates specific certifications and tools due to its hazardous nature. It is both unsafe and against the law for individuals without professional qualifications to manage refrigerant. To ensure safety and compliance, always engage the services of a licensed HVAC technician for any tasks involving refrigerant.

Q3: How often should I schedule AC maintenance?

A3: Annual maintenance is crucial for ensuring your air conditioner operates at peak efficiency. Nonetheless, depending on your specific unit, the manufacturer might advise more regular servicing. Adhering to these recommendations can significantly enhance your AC’s performance and longevity, avoiding potential breakdowns.

Q4: What can I do to prevent future AC issues?

A4: Frequent replacement of air filters, maintaining cleanliness around the outdoor unit, and arranging for annual professional maintenance are key measures to ward off typical air conditioner issues. Implementing these proactive steps ensures your AC system remains in optimal working condition, minimizing the likelihood of operational problems.

Q5: Is it normal for my AC unit to make unusual sounds?

A5: Hearing abnormal noises such as grinding, squealing, or banging from your air conditioner signals potential internal issues. Upon detecting these sounds, it’s critical to immediately shut off the unit to prevent further damage. Promptly contacting a technician for a thorough inspection is essential to diagnose and resolve the underlying problem effectively.
